    Abstract:

    The chimeric gene of ACTH(4-10) with GDNF was constructed by PCR amplification. The fused gene was inserted into the expression vector pET-28a(+) and expressed in E.coli. with a level of 30% of the total bacterial proteins. The expressed product was purified by Ni2+-NTA resin, up to 85% purity. The results of activity assays showed that the chimeric protein could significantly promote the survival of spinal cord neurons and had a higher neurotrophic activity than ACTH(4-10) and GDNF respectively.
